Discovery Parks – Bright

Located on the banks of the Ovens River with views of nearby Mount Feathertop, Discovery Parks Bright is seven kilometres from the Bright town centre and well located for making the most of Victoria’s High Country. Here you will find fantastic facilities including a heated pool, camp kitchens, playground, jumping pillow, and direct access to walking and cycling trails. Bright Skatepark

Situated in Lions Park, a short distance from Bright Central Business District, the Bright Skate Park is close to a picnic shelter and across the road from Centenary Park. The park includes a six feet high metal half-pipe and a street section with ramps, quarters, rails, ledges and steps. A picnic shelter is located adjacent to the half pipe. Some features include: Ramps, Rails and Half Pipe.
